What’s Driving the Bittensor TAO Sideways Movement?

For weeks, Bittensor TAO has demonstrated limited movement around the $412 level. This consolidation is not new; the token has traded within a broad $190–$740 range since 2023. Its current price of $411.98 reflects a tight 24-hour trading range between $404.03 and $435.40. Despite a brief attempt to push above $430 earlier, TAO quickly retreated, settling back into the $404–$412 zone.

This persistent sideways action indicates a fierce tug-of-war between buyers and sellers. While support at $404 has largely held, the token has consistently failed to breach the $435–$437 resistance levels, forming a pattern of declining highs and lows. Crypto analyst Ali Martinez highlighted the significance of the current price, noting, “TAO’s current price is at a midpoint of a long-established range, which could signal a potential breakout or reversal.” The $412 level is now seen as a crucial decision zone, dictating the market’s immediate direction.

Decoding the Drop in Crypto Trading Volume

Adding another layer of complexity to TAO price action is the noticeable decline in trading volume. Over the past 24 hours, Bittensor’s trading volume dropped by 17.33% to $194.9 million. This contraction in crypto trading volume signals reduced market participation and, crucially, a lack of conviction among traders. While technical indicators like the Relative Strength Index (RSI) on the 1-minute chart neared 70 (suggesting overbought conditions) and the Moving Average Convergence Divergence (MACD) hinted at short-term bullish momentum, the falling volume undermines the strength of these signals. Low volume breakouts or breakdowns are often unreliable, leading to false signals that can trap unsuspecting traders.

Navigating TAO Price: Key Resistance and Support Levels

For traders focused on TAO analysis, understanding the critical price levels is paramount. The immediate resistance zone lies between $435 and $437. A sustained break above this level could pave the way for a move towards the $450–$470 range. Conversely, the primary support rests at $404. Should this level fail to hold, the price could retrace further toward the $390 zone. The market’s next significant move will likely depend on whether TAO can successfully retest and break its resistance or if it succumbs to selling pressure and tests lower support.

The failure of the price to sustain gains above $430 earlier in the day clearly illustrates the prevailing selling pressure at these higher levels. This indicates that while there might be buying interest at lower prices, there isn’t enough momentum to overcome the resistance and establish a clear uptrend.

Technical Indicators and the Future of TAO Analysis

Beyond price levels, technical indicators offer insights into potential short-term movements. As mentioned, the 1-minute RSI touched overbought territory, and the MACD showed bullish momentum. However, these signals are on very short timeframes and are significantly diluted by the declining volume. In a low-volume environment, minor price movements can trigger indicator signals that don’t reflect broader market sentiment or conviction. For a reliable uptrend, a strong influx of buying volume would be necessary to confirm any bullish technical readings.
